Ankle range of motion... i x Examen • 19 páginas • por NurseAmy • subido 2022 Vista rápida i x Nursing assessment • Nursing assessment 2022 HESI RN EVOLVE Medical-Surgical Assignment Exam (0) $7.99 0x vendido Which assessment is most important for the nurse to perform on a client who is hospitalized for 
Guillain-Barre syndrome that is rapidly progressing? 
A: Respiratory effort. 
B: Unsteady gait. 
C: Intensity of pain. 
D: Ability to eat. 
A: Respiratory Effort 
(Guillain-Barre syndrome causes paralysis or weakness that typically starts at the feet and progresses 
upwards. As the condition progresses, the nurse must ensure that the client is able to breathe 
effectively.)
